A multimodal ophthalmic analysis in patients with systemic sclerosis using ocular response analyzer, corneal topography and specular microscopy.

Abstract

PURPOSE

To conduct a multimodal ophthalmic evaluation of systemic sclerosis (SSc) in patients using ocular response analyzer (ORA), Pentacam, and specular microscopy (SM).

METHODS

Thirty-one SSc patients and a group of age- and sex-matched controls were enrolled in this cross-sectional study. Corneal hysteresis (CH), corneal resistance factor (CRF), corneal-compensated intraocular pressure (IOPcc), and Goldmann-correlated IOP (IOPg) were measured with ORA. Anterior chamber depth (ACD), central corneal thickness (CCT), and corneal volume (CV) measurements were obtained using Pentacam. Corneal endothelial cell density (ECD) and CCT were evaluated by SM.

RESULTS

SSc patients had significantly lower CH, ACD, and ECD values compared to the control group (p = 0.018; < 0.001; < 0.001, respectively). There was no significant difference regarding CRF, IOP, CV, or CCT measurements acquired by Pentacam and SM. Regarding CCT, SM and Pentacam showed relatively better agreement in SSc patients.

CONCLUSIONS

Multimodal imaging can provide more comprehensive and useful information regarding the ocular involvement of systemic diseases. The multimodal evaluation in our study demonstrated that the pathologic effects of SSc may manifest as reductions in ACD, corneal elasticity, and ECD before there are any detectable changes in corneal thickness or IOP.

摘要

目的

使用眼反应分析仪(ORA)、Pentacam 和共焦显微镜(SM)对系统性硬化症(SSc)患者进行多模态眼科评估。

方法

本横断面研究纳入了 31 名 SSc 患者和一组年龄及性别匹配的对照组。使用 ORA 测量角膜滞后(CH)、角膜阻力因子(CRF)、角膜补偿眼压(IOPcc)和 Goldmann 相关眼压(IOPg)。使用 Pentacam 测量前房深度(ACD)、中央角膜厚度(CCT)和角膜容积(CV)。通过 SM 评估角膜内皮细胞密度(ECD)和 CCT。

结果

与对照组相比,SSc 患者的 CH、ACD 和 ECD 值显著降低(p = 0.018; < 0.001; < 0.001)。Pentacam 和 SM 测量的 CRF、IOP、CV 或 CCT 无显著差异。关于 CCT,SM 和 Pentacam 在 SSc 患者中的一致性相对较好。

结论

多模态成像可以提供更全面、更有用的关于系统性疾病眼部受累的信息。我们的研究中的多模态评估表明,在角膜厚度或眼压出现任何可检测到的变化之前,SSc 的病理效应可能表现为 ACD、角膜弹性和 ECD 的降低。
